Name:Saxon spear, St Mary's Church, Chislet

Summary

Saxon spear, fragments of 2 knives and a pin were found in the N-w corner of the new churchyard. The site is on the upper part of a gentle south-east facing slope. OD 15-20m.

[TR 22306425] Saxon spear found April 1949. (1) On exhibition in Chislet Parish Church are a spearhead, fragments of 2 knives and a pin, believed to be 4th century A.D. discovered in February 1949 by Mr. P. Male, sexton, whilst digging a grave in the N.W. corner of the new churchyard (a). The finds are in poor condition. Authority 1's siting was confirmed by Mr. Male. (2) Additional bibliography (3-4)
